| 1.9 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 4/10 | 2/5 | 4/10 | 2/5 | 7/20 | Aug 1, 2007 It has been reported that Mark Knoble from the brewery states it is a all malt pale lager brewed with pure lemons. So it IS a beer. So if it is learned that I have been duped so be it. Cloudy light straw color with a nearly instantly vanishing white head. All that is left is a white ring around the edge of the glass. Heavy lemon aroma, not overly sweet, but certainly lemons. Hints of dry grains, similar to granary filled with oats. Light lemon grass as well. Sweet lemon start that has a quick side diversion with soap, cardboard and grain. Very little malt presence. Finish has more lime than lemon flavors. Very small amount of malt noted in the linger, yet the sweet somewhat sticky lemon juice remains. Don’t know the marketing aspects, but I would rush into the fruit beer market at this time. | 3.4 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 6/10 | 3/5 | 7/10 | 3/5 | 15/20 | Dec 2, 2007 Updated: Jun 30, 2008Picked up single 12-oz bottle from Flanagan’s Liquors in Appleton, WI. Pours a semi-cloudy pale yellowish straw brew with a fizzy white head that has some good retention and lacing. Aroma of sweetened lemonade, some corn syrup, light bready malt and no detected hop character. Taste is medium bodied, smooth, well-carbonated with a more decent lemonade flavor than most other lemon fruit beers I’ve tried. Finish is slightly tart lemon flavor that is a decent summer refresher. According to the brewery this is a multi-grain malt lager brewed with real lemons. Ughsmash (4079), Waukesha, Wisconsin, USA
